How New Cambria saw the hail — from two instruments
Two instruments, one storm: NEXRAD logs the point signatures it detected overhead, while the estimated-size surface models how large the hail aloft could have grown. Agreement between them is not guaranteed — the gaps are where the model ran ahead of, or behind, the detections.
Estimated size field Radar-estimated maximum hail size across the swath, modeled from radar aloft. It reflects the biggest stone the storm could support, which may differ from what actually fell.

The storm in context
Where Sep 15, 2026 sits in New Cambria's hail record.
This was New Cambria's 9th recorded hail day, arriving 41 days after the Aug 5, 2026 storm. By severity it ranks 9th of the 9 storms we have logged here. Radar put the day's largest stone over New Cambria at 0.5" — radar-estimated size aloft.
The Sep 15, 2026 convective day was bigger than New Cambria: the same system put hail over 169 other tracked cities, 35 of them in Missouri. Nearest: Salisbury (9 miles southeast, up to 1.25"); Marceline (11 miles west, up to 0.75"); Brookfield (16 miles west, up to 0.75").

Below the severe threshold
What 0.5" hail means for New Cambria roofs.
Radar signals under three-quarters of an inch stay below the National Weather Service severe threshold and generally indicate lower roof risk. Older or already-worn materials can still show effects, but radar alone cannot determine whether a specific roof was damaged.
